Dogecoin, often simply referred to as ‘Doge’, is a digital currency that has gained popularity in recent years. It was created in 2013 by software engineers Billy Markus and Jackson Palmer as a playful and lighthearted alternative to Bitcoin. The name ‘Dogecoin’ is derived from the popular internet meme featuring a Shiba Inu dog with broken English captions.

Despite its humorous origins, Dogecoin has become a serious player in the world of cryptocurrency. It has a strong and active community of supporters who use the currency for various online transactions and fundraising efforts. Dogecoin has also gained attention for its philanthropic initiatives, including sponsoring NASCAR drivers and funding charitable causes.

The value of Dogecoin has fluctuated over the years, but its popularity has remained strong. It has attracted a diverse range of users, from casual internet users to serious investors.
